Marijuana is grown from one of two sources: a seed or a clone. Seeds bring genetic info from 2 parent plants and can reveal various combinations of characteristics: some from the mother, some from the dad, and some qualities from both. In industrial cannabis production, generally, growers will plant numerous seeds of one strain and pick the very best plant. Growing from seed can produce a stronger plant with more solid genes. Plants grown from seed can be more hearty as young plants when compared to clones, generally due to the fact that seeds have a strong taproot. You can plant seeds straight into an outside garden in early spring, even in cool, wet climates. If growing outdoors, some growers choose to sprout seeds inside since they are fragile in the beginning stages of development. Inside, you can offer weed seedlings supplemental light to assist them along, and after that transplant them outside when big enough. You'll need to sex them out (more listed below) to determine the males and get rid of them, since you do not desire your women producing seeds - best feminized seeds. Sexing marijuana plants can be a time-consuming process, and if you don't catch males, there is a danger that even one males can pollinate your entire crop, causing all of your female weed plants to produce seeds. One way to prevent sexing plants is to buy feminized seeds (more listed below), which guarantees every seed you plant will be a bud-producing female. You can likewise lessen headaches and prevent the trouble of seed germination and sexing plants by beginning with clones.
A clone is a cutting that is genetically identical to the plant it was taken fromthat plant is referred to as the "mother." Through cloning, you can create a new harvest with specific reproductions of your favorite plant. Since genes are identical, a clone will offer you a plant with the exact same qualities as the mother, such as taste, cannabinoid profile, yield, grow time, and so on. So if you stumble upon a particular pressure or phenotype you really like, you may wish to clone it to replicate more buds that have the same impacts and characteristics. Feminized marijuana seeds will produce only female plants for getting buds, so there is no requirement to get rid of males or stress over female plants getting pollinated. Feminized seeds are produced by causing the monoecious condition in a female marijuana plantthe resulting seeds are almost identical to the self-pollinated female parent, as only one set of genes is present.

They are simple to grow since you don't need to fret about light cycles and how much light a plant gets. A lot of marijuana plants start blooming when the quantity of light they get on an everyday basis decreases. Outdoors, this happens when the sun begins setting previously in the day as the season turns from summertime to fall. Indoor growers can control when a plant flowers by reducing the day-to-day amount of light plants get from 18 hours to 12 hours - feminized autoflowering seeds usa.
Autoflowers can be begun in early spring and will flower during the longest days of summer, taking advantage of high quality light to get larger yields. CBD, or cannabidiol, is one of the chemical componentsknown collectively as cannabinoidsfound in the cannabis plant. For many years, people have actually selected plants for high-THC material, making marijuana with high levels of CBD uncommon. The hereditary pathways through which THC is manufactured by the plant are various than those for CBD production. Marijuana used for hemp production has actually been selected for other qualities, including a low THC material, so as to comply with the 2018 Farm Expense.
As interest in CBD as a medication has grown, many breeders have crossed high-CBD hemp with marijuana. These stress have little or no THC, 1:1 ratios of THC and CBD, or some have a high-THC content together with significant amounts of CBD (3% or more). Cannabis seeds require 3 things to sprout: water, heat, and air. There are many techniques to sprout seeds, however for the most common and simplest method, you will require: Two clean plates, Four paper towels, Seeds, Distilled water Take 4 sheets of paper towels and soak them with pure water. The towels must be soaked but shouldn't have excess water running off.
Then, put the marijuana seeds a minimum of an inch apart from each other and cover them with the staying 2 water-soaked paper towels. To create a dark, secured space, take another plate and turn it over to cover the seeds, like a dome. Ensure the area the seeds are in is warm, someplace between 70-85F. After finishing these actions, it's time to wait. Check the paper towels as soon as a day to make sure they're still saturated, and if they are losing moisture, apply more water to keep the seeds delighted - feminized seeds. Some seeds sprout extremely quickly while others can take a while, however generally, seeds ought to sprout in 3-10 days.
A seed has actually germinated when the seed divides and a single grow appears. The grow is the taproot, which will become the primary stem of the plant, and seeing it suggests effective germination. It's crucial to keep the fragile seed sterilized, so do not touch the seed or taproot as it starts to split.
